Healthy diet width=Cholesterol is in many fats and oils, but it is a fat. It is a part of many important body substances such as hormones, and structures including the brain and nerves. But too much cholesterol in your blood can clog your arteries.

You’ve probably heard about “good” cholesterol and “bad” cholesterol. Bad cholesterol or LDL cholesterol, which is an abbreviation in English of low-density lipoprotein, can clog your arteries and lead to heart disease. Good cholesterol or HDL cholesterol, which is the English abbreviation for high-density lipoprotein carries unneeded cholesterol away from body tissues, so it lowers your risk of heart disease.

If your doctor says your cholesterol level is too high, what can you do about it? It helps to lose weight and eat a healthy diet. Your diet should limit the amount of fatty and cholesterol-rich foods you eat. (more…)

Tips for Diet, Physical Activity and Cholesterol

Friday, February 5th, 2010

Nutrition and physical activity have a major impact on your cholesterol. Eating healthy diet and regular exercise can help lower your cholesterol or to maintain a normal level. Similarly, lack of exercise and poor diet choices send upwards cholesterol.

Beware Food

Saturated fat is the main culprit for high cholesterol food. Saturated fats are usually found in marbled meat, poultry skin and full fat dairy products. Experts recommend limiting saturated fat to less than 10 percent of your daily calories. Reduce your consumption of saturated fats has been proven that lower LDL-cholesterol. (more…)
